PLANET, the Professional Landcare Network, is an international association serving lawn care professionals, exterior maintenance contractors, installation/design/build professionals, and interiorscapers. PLANET emerged on January 1, 2005, when the Associated Landscape Contractors of America (ALCA) and the Professional Lawn Care Association of America (PLCAA) joined forces to become a more encompassing network of green industry professionals. PLANET hosts an annual competition in all the skills of the profession, along with a Career Fair where important national firms recruit. Students spend fall and winter preparing for the competition, and raising funds for the trip. These skills are being integrated into Landscape Horticulture course curricula to improve students' qualifications for optimum employment.
